Bosschaart wrote: > On Wed, Sep 20, 2000 at 12:16:33AM -0400, Trevor Daniel Kramer wrote: > > I just installed the UT Retail via the install script from Loki's site and > > it appears to have installed properly and I have installed the linux-glide > > drivers but I am getting an error while starting ut: > > ./ut-bin: error in loading shared libraries: libesd.so.0: cannot > > open shared object file: No such file or directory > > > > Does anyone know where to get this library? I have to install it in the > > /compat/linux/ . . . directory right? Thanks. > > > Did you check out http://www.lokigames.com/~overcode/ ? There's an archive > called ut-compat.tar.gz that contains following libraries: > > libaudiofile.so.0.0.0 > libesd.so.0.2.14 > libGL.so.1.0 > libGLU.so.1.2.0 > libgtk-1.2.so.0.5.1 > libgdk-1.2.so.0.5.1 > libglib-1.2.so.0.0.6 > > They should be placed in /compat/linux/usr/lib and provide some libs that > are not included by default in linux_base. I have also added libmikmod (as > an rpm) to get the cool UT music. > > Don't forget to run /compat/linux/sbin/ldconfig... be sure NOT to run > FreeBSD's ldconfig. > > You might want to check out Loki's news archives. There was a post called > 'Unofficial FreeBSD instructions' containing instructions and the link to > ut-compat.tar.gz.
